Description For Network Developer

Oracle is seeking a Network Development Engineer to join their team in building and managing services for OCI networks. This role combines network engineering expertise with software development skills to create comprehensive solutions for network automation and management.

The position requires a unique blend of network operations experience and programming capabilities, particularly in Python. You'll be working on large-scale infrastructure that supports millions of servers across a global footprint, using both dedicated backbone infrastructure and Internet connectivity.

As a Network Development Engineer, you'll be responsible for building and managing services that model, provision, secure, scale, and operate OCI networks. You'll work with network automation systems to represent complex datacenter networks and implement solutions that enable central administration of OCI's network infrastructure.

This role requires an active Top Secret/SCI security clearance with polygraph, indicating work on sensitive and critical infrastructure. You'll be part of an on-call rotation, ensuring 24/7 reliability of network systems.

Oracle offers a comprehensive benefits package including medical, dental, and vision insurance, 401(k) with company match, paid time off, and stock purchase plans. The position offers competitive compensation with a salary range of $79,100 to $158,200, plus potential equity.

The ideal candidate will have 3-5+ years of network engineering experience, strong Python programming skills, and excellent communication abilities. Experience with protocols like BGP, OSPF, IS-IS, and TCP/UDP, as well as familiarity with network monitoring tools like Prometheus and Grafana, would be highly valuable.

Responsibilities For Network Developer

  • Build & manage services that comprehensively model, provision, secure, scale and operate OCI networks
  • Use network automation to represent complex datacenter networks
  • Build, interconnect and scale networks
  • Centrally administer OCI's networks
  • Automate responses to common operational problems using the network automation API

Requirements For Network Developer

Python
Linux
  • US Government active Top Secret/ SCI security clearance with polygraph
  • Bachelor's degree in CS or related engineer field 5+ years Network Engineer experience or Masters with 2+ years Network Engineer experience
  • Experience and interest to work in a network operations role
  • Extensive experience with scripting or automation and datacenter design – Python preferred
  • Excellent organizational, verbal, and written communication skills
  • Required to participate in an on call rotation
